Best autumn sun destinations for UK travellers

September through November brings crisp mornings at home, but Europe and beyond are still gloriously warm. The trick is knowing where the sun actually shines when British skies turn grey—and where tourist hordes have already gone home.

Why this list?

We've picked destinations where autumn weather is genuinely reliable, not just theoretically possible. Some Mediterranean spots are rainy by October; these aren't. We've also focused on places where September–November actually feels like shoulder season rather than peak summer's tail end, meaning better prices and fewer queues. We've left out destinations that demand you fly for 8+ hours or require visas most of us don't have.

Our picks

  1. Málaga, Spain — Southern Spain's coast keeps temperatures above 25°C well into November, and September days often hit 30°C. The region is packed with whitewashed villages, sherry bodegas, and reasonably priced paella. Late-season beach time is possible; early-autumn hiking in the hills is excellent. Budget airlines make flights cheap; expect mid-range hotels around £60–90 per night.
  2. Lisbon, Portugal — Autumn here is genuinely pleasant: warm but not scorching, with golden light perfect for photography. The city's neighbourhoods—Alfama, Belém, Príncipe Real—reveal themselves better in quieter weather. Pastéis de Nata, port wine, and riverside walks are autumn favourites. Accommodation and food remain affordable, with double rooms from £50–75.
  3. Greek Islands (Crete, Rhodes, Kos) — These larger islands shake off peak-season chaos by mid-September but stay sunny and warm. Sea temperatures remain swimmable through October. Less crowded tavernas, lower rates on villas, and clearer starlit nights. Crete particularly rewards autumn exploration with fewer tour groups in archaeological sites. Budget £40–70 for decent mid-range accommodation.
  4. Southern Turkey (Antalya Coast) — The turquoise Mediterranean waters and pine-backed beaches feel almost post-apocalyptically quiet by October. Temperatures stay above 25°C, and September often sees 30°C+. Ancient ruins (Perge, Aspendos) are less overwhelming without summer crowds. Turkish cuisine, affordability, and direct flights from the UK make this underrated. Expect £30–50 for mid-range hotels.
  5. Malta — A small island nation that stays genuinely warm through November, with water temperatures of 20–22°C perfect for diving and swimming. September weather is hot and dry. The autumn light is beautifully soft, and prehistoric temples and honey-coloured architecture photograph wonderfully. Compact enough for a long weekend; direct flights from most UK airports. Budget £60–90 for accommodation.
  6. Canary Islands, Spain — Often overlooked for autumn, these islands have a subtropical climate that keeps temperatures between 24–28°C year-round. September and October are slightly quieter than winter; November remains sunny and warm. Tenerife, Gran Canaria, and Lanzarote all reward hiking, beach days, and exploring volcanic landscapes. Cheap internal flights between islands; accommodation from £50–80.
  7. Cyprus — Warm and dry through November, with September temperatures reaching 32°C and settling to a pleasant 25°C by late October. The Troodos Mountains offer cooler hiking; coastal towns stay bustling but less frantic. Beaches, Byzantine churches, and taverna dinners overlooking the Mediterranean all feel authentically seasonal. Flights are often reasonable; expect £50–75 for hotels.
  8. Southern Italy (Amalfi, Sicily) — Autumn is actually when this region shines: September still warm (around 28°C), October settling to 23°C, but crowds departing dramatically. The light is softer, restaurants quieter, and the sea still warm enough for swimming. Sicily's food, culture, and coastline reward a slower pace. Accommodation drops noticeably; budget £60–100 for mid-range stays.

How to book it cheaply

Travel mid-week and avoid school half-term weeks to unlock better prices on flights and hotels. Book accommodation directly with smaller hotels and guesthouses—many reduce rates by 20–30% for multi-night stays in shoulder season. For flights, set up price alerts six to eight weeks ahead; budget airlines often release September and October sales in June. Consider flying mid-week (Tuesday–Thursday) rather than Friday–Sunday. Restaurant meals in these destinations are genuinely affordable compared to the UK, so don't skimp on dining out; it's often cheaper than self-catering.
